#011fd4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#011fd4 is composed of 0.4% red, 12.2%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.5% cyan, 85.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 231.5 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 41.8%. #011fd4 color hex could be obtained by blending #023eff with #0000a9.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

Shades and Tints of #011fd4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000211 is the darkest color, while #fcf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#011fd4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#636572 is the less saturated color, while #011fd4 is the most saturated one.
